summaryrefslogtreecommitdiff
path: root/noncore/settings/appearance2/appearance.h
Unidiff
Diffstat (limited to 'noncore/settings/appearance2/appearance.h') (more/less context) (show whitespace changes)
-rw-r--r--noncore/settings/appearance2/appearance.h30
1 files changed, 20 insertions, 10 deletions
diff --git a/noncore/settings/appearance2/appearance.h b/noncore/settings/appearance2/appearance.h
index a392aa7..065dfb7 100644
--- a/noncore/settings/appearance2/appearance.h
+++ b/noncore/settings/appearance2/appearance.h
@@ -32,5 +32,4 @@
32#include <qpe/fontdatabase.h> 32#include <qpe/fontdatabase.h>
33 33
34#include <qmainwindow.h>
35#include <qdialog.h> 34#include <qdialog.h>
36 35
@@ -46,4 +45,7 @@ class QToolButton;
46class SampleWindow; 45class SampleWindow;
47class OFontSelector; 46class OFontSelector;
47class QListView;
48class QListViewItem;
49class Config;
48 50
49class Appearance : public QDialog 51class Appearance : public QDialog
@@ -70,16 +72,20 @@ protected slots:
70 void deleteSchemeClicked(); 72 void deleteSchemeClicked();
71 73
72private: 74 void tabChanged ( QWidget * );
73 void loadStyles ( QListBox * ); 75
74 void loadDecos ( QListBox * ); 76 void addExcept ( );
75 void loadColors ( QListBox * ); 77 void delExcept ( );
78 void upExcept ( );
79 void downExcept ( );
80 void clickedExcept ( QListViewItem *, const QPoint &, int );
76 81
82private:
77 void changeText(); 83 void changeText();
78 84
79 QWidget *createStyleTab ( QWidget *parent ); 85 QWidget *createStyleTab ( QWidget *parent, Config &cfg );
80 QWidget *createDecoTab ( QWidget *parent ); 86 QWidget *createDecoTab ( QWidget *parent, Config &cfg );
81 QWidget *createFontTab ( QWidget *parent ); 87 QWidget *createFontTab ( QWidget *parent, Config &cfg );
82 QWidget *createColorTab ( QWidget *parent ); 88 QWidget *createColorTab ( QWidget *parent, Config &cfg );
83 QWidget *createGuiTab ( QWidget *parent ); 89 QWidget *createAdvancedTab ( QWidget *parent, Config &cfg );
84 90
85private: 91private:
@@ -109,4 +115,8 @@ private:
109 QRadioButton *m_tabstyle_top; 115 QRadioButton *m_tabstyle_top;
110 QRadioButton *m_tabstyle_bottom; 116 QRadioButton *m_tabstyle_bottom;
117
118 QWidget * m_advtab;
119 QListView * m_except;
120 QCheckBox * m_force;
111}; 121};
112 122